"The Childhood of Distinguished Women" by Selina A. Bower is a collection of historical stories that looks at the early lives of famous women. The book tells about the childhoods, schooling, and beliefs that helped shape women like Princess Alice, Hannah More, and Queen Elizabeth I. It shows how their early experiences and problems prepared them for their important roles in society. Each chapter talks about their families, how they grew up, and what they were like as people, all while keeping in mind what society expected of them back then. Bower focuses on the good qualities and successes that came from their childhoods, presenting these women as examples of good character and smarts. Through interesting stories and historical details, the book hopes to motivate readers with the amazing stories of these well-known women and what they accomplished.
